About the Atlanta Tipoff Club  Founded during the 1956-57 season, the Atlanta Tipoff Club is committed to promoting the game of basketball and recognizing the outstanding accomplishments of those who make the game so exciting. The Atlanta Tipoff Club administers the Naismith Awards, the most prestigious national honors in all of college and high school basketball. Named in honor of Dr. James Naismith, inventor of the game of basketball, the family of Naismith Awards annually recognizes the most outstanding men’s and women’s college and high school basketball players and coaches. Other Naismith Awards are presented to the men’s and women’s college basketball defensive players of the year, as well as lifetime achievement awards to basketball officials and outstanding contributors to the game. UCLA’s Lew Alcindor received the first Jersey Mike’s Naismith Trophy in 1969, while the late Anne Donovan (Old Dominion) was the inaugural women’s recipient in 1983.  Corporate partners of the Naismith Awards include AXIA Time, Jersey Mike’s and Werner Ladder.

Evocative of the iconic trophy, the Heisman DIASIMOS  is an eye-catching study in black and bronze powered by renowned Swiss brand Sellita’s SW300 Elabore, a 31-jewel self-winding, automatic movement which operates at a frequency of 28,800 VpH (4Hz) and has a power reserve of 56 hours. At 40.5 mm, the watch’s striking bronze-plated titanium #5 case with DLC coating features a split coin-edge bezel and a fine-tooth crown adorned with the iconic Heisman logo. The piece’s sapphire crystal caseback displays the SW300 Elabore movement with its unique custom rotor as well as an engraving ring which provides dedicated space to honor the individual player. To ensure stylish comfort and the ease of use necessary for daily wear, the watch is presented on an American-made, black square-scale alligator strap with contrast stitching which closes via a bronze-plated deployant buckle embellished with the Heisman logo. About The Tewaaraton Foundation The Tewaaraton Award is recognized as the preeminent lacrosse award, annually honoring the top male and female college lacrosse player in the United States. Founded at the University Club of Washington, D.C., the award was first presented in 2001 with permission from the Mohawk Nation Council of Elders. "Tewaaraton" is the Mohawk word for lacrosse, and The Tewaaraton Award symbolizes lacrosse's Native American Heritage. The Tewaaraton Foundation ensures the integrity of the selection process and advances the mission of the Foundation. Each year, The Tewaaraton Foundation presents two scholarships to students from the Haudenosaunee Confederacy – the Mohawk, Cayuga, Oneida, Onondaga, Seneca, and Tuscarora Nations.
